Bayesian three-dimensional seismic travel-time tomography for active- and passive-source seismic data using physics-informed neural network

利用主动源与被动源地震走时数据进行高精度三维地震波速建模,是地震活动监测与灾害评估的关键基础。由于走时反演本质上是病态逆问题,基于贝叶斯方法的不确定性量化对下游分析至关重要。然而,传统基于网格的三维贝叶斯反演面临维度灾难与严重计算瓶颈,导致大范围三维走时反演的严格不确定性量化长期未被探索。本文提出一种无网格的三维贝叶斯走时反演方法,结合物理信息神经网络(PINN)与神经网络表示的速度结构,通过函数空间粒子变分推断实现可处理且数据高效的贝叶斯推断。为高效融合被动源数据,我们采用解析边缘化处理,将不确定的震源参数视为无关参数,并在后处理中完成被动源重定位。通过合成实验验证了该方法在三维问题上的能力。进一步应用于日本南海海槽近岸海域的海洋主动源调查与天然地震真实数据集。其概率性三维集成模型成功揭示关键地质特征,并提供与数据一致的不确定性分布。后验震源位置主要垂直移动10-15公里,与先前重定位结果一致。此外,神经网络表示大幅降低整个速度模型集合的存储需求,凸显所提框架的可扩展性与数据效率。

Accurate 3D seismic velocity modeling through seismic travel-time tomography using both active- and passive-source data provides critical underpinning models for seismicity monitoring and hazard assessment. Because travel-time tomography is an inherently ill-posed inverse problem, UQ of the estimated models using Bayesian methods is also important for reliable downstream interpretations and analyses. However, Bayesian inference for 3D tomography based on conventional grid-based representations faces the ``curse of dimensionality'' and severe computational bottlenecks. Consequently, rigorous Bayesian UQ for margin-wide 3D travel-time tomography has remained largely unexplored. In this study, we propose a meshless 3D Bayesian travel-time tomography method that combines PINNs with a neural representation of the velocity structure, enabling tractable and data-efficient Bayesian inference through function-space particle-based variational inference. To efficiently integrate passive-source data into the Bayesian estimation of the velocity structure, we conduct analytical marginalization treating uncertain source parameters as nuisance parameters, with passive-source relocation carried out in post-processing. We validated the capability of our approach for 3D problems through synthetic experiments. Furthermore, we applied the method to a real-world dataset from marine active-source surveys and natural earthquakes off the Kii Peninsula, Nankai Trough. Our probabilistic 3D ensemble successfully resolves key geological features and provides data-consistent uncertainty maps. The posterior mean hypocenters shifted mainly in the vertical direction by 10-15 km, consistent with a previous relocation result. Finally, the neural representation drastically reduces storage requirements for the entire ensemble velocity model, highlighting the scalability and data efficiency of the proposed framework.
